Job Description: Responsible and accountable for independently providing quality professional speech therapy services to patients and their families and significant others adhering to the Wisconsin Speech Therapy Practice Act and Bellin Health Policies and Procedures. The responsibility includes providing a safe environment for patients, staff, and visitors and working collaboratively with the multidisciplinary health care team to provide the best outcomes for the patient. Performs and documents speech evaluations and swallow studies, treatments, and discharge evaluations of patients according to established patient goals consistent with physician referrals. Qualifications: Wisconsin State Speech Language pathologist license; or proof currently in Clinical Fellowship Year (CFY) obtaining Clinical Competency Certificate (CCC) and Wisconsin State license within one year of hire required.
